This is a picture of an ancient area in York called 'The Shambles'. It was an area where nearly every shop was a butcher's shop. The "shammels" were the benches on which the meat was displayed. The shop keepers threw their garbage and trash into the streets. The grooves in the pavement were put there so the refuse could run off when it rained. Must have been a real pleasant area in which to shop. Today, it has been transformed into an area filled with trendy shops of all kinds. The Shambles, York
